Hive 修改责任人语句
1. 背景介绍
Hive 是一个基于 Hadoop 的数据仓库工具,它提供了类 SQL 的查询语言来分析大规模的数据。在 Hive 中,可以创建表格来存储数据,并用于执行各种查询操作。当一个表格被创建后,可能需要修改表格的责任人信息。本文将介绍在 Hive 中如何修改表格的责任人。
2. 修改责任人的语法
要修改 Hive 表格的责任人,可以使用 ALTER TABLE 语句,并指定表格的 LOCATION 属性和新的责任人信息。以下是修改责任人的语法示例:
ALTER TABLE table_name SET TBLPROPERTIES ('OWNER' = 'new_owner');
在上面的语句中,table_name
是要修改责任人的表格的名称,new_owner
是新的责任人的用户名。
3. 示例
假设我们有一个表格叫做 employees
,我们想修改它的责任人为 john.doe
。以下是修改责任人的示例代码:
ALTER TABLE employees SET TBLPROPERTIES ('OWNER' = 'john.doe');
4. 效果演示
我们可以使用 DESCRIBE
命令来查看表格的属性,包括责任人信息。以下是修改责任人后的 employees
表格的描述示例:
DESCRIBE EXTENDED employees;
col_name | data_type | comment | |
---|---|---|---|
1 | employee_id | int | |
2 | employee_name | string | |
3 | department | string | |
Owner | string | john.doe |
上面的表格示例中,我们可以看到 Owner
属性已经被修改为 john.doe
。
5. 结论
通过使用 Hive 的 ALTER TABLE 语句,我们可以轻松修改表格的责任人。这对于管理和维护大规模数据仓库非常有用。在实际应用中,可以根据需要使用相应的用户名来修改表格的责任人信息。
以上就是关于 Hive 修改责任人语句的简要介绍和示例代码。希望本文能够帮助读者理解如何在 Hive 中修改表格的责任人信息。
6. 饼状图
下面是一个使用 mermaid 语法绘制的饼状图的示例,用于展示数据分布情况。
pie
"Category 1" : 40
"Category 2" : 25
"Category 3" : 35
以上代码将会生成一个简单的饼状图,其中分别展示了三个类别的数据分布情况。
希望以上介绍的内容对你理解 Hive 修改责任人语句有所帮助!